The Future of Full Stack Development in a Data-Driven World
Not long ago, a Full Stack Developer’s primary responsibility was to build applications.
Today, that’s only part of the story.
Businesses now generate enormous amounts of data every day—from customer interactions and sales transactions to operational metrics and performance reports. As organizations become increasingly data-driven, they’re looking for developers who can do more than build software. They need professionals who can transform information into solutions.
The future of Full Stack Development isn’t just about creating applications.
It’s about helping businesses make better decisions.
So what do high-performing customer service professionals do differently?
The Shift From Building Features to Solving Problems
Many people associate software development with writing code.
But businesses don’t invest in software because they want more code. They invest in software because they have problems they want solved.
Maybe a leadership team lacks visibility into company performance.
Maybe employees spend hours creating manual reports.
Maybe customer information exists across multiple disconnected systems.
These aren’t technology problems alone—they’re business problems.
Modern Full Stack Developers help bridge that gap by creating applications, integrations, and reporting tools that make information easier to access and act upon.
Why Data Skills Are Becoming More Valuable
Every application relies on data.
Whether it’s customer information, financial records, inventory management, or operational reporting, data sits at the center of nearly every business process.
That’s why skills such as SQL, database management, reporting, and data integration continue to be highly valuable.
A Full Stack Developer with strong data expertise can:
- Build efficient applications
- Create meaningful reports and dashboards
- Improve data accuracy
- Automate repetitive processes
- Support better business decisions
In many cases, the most valuable feature isn’t a new screen or workflow—it’s giving people access to the right information at the right time.
Automation Is Changing the Way Businesses Operate
One of the biggest opportunities for developers today is automation.
Many organizations still rely on manual processes for reporting, data entry, and information sharing.
A Full Stack Developer can use technologies like SQL Server, APIs, ETL processes, and cloud platforms to automate these tasks and improve efficiency.
The result?
Less time spent on repetitive work and more time focused on strategic decisions.
Good software doesn’t just make tasks faster. It allows people to focus on work that creates greater value.
AI Won't Replace Developers—But It Will Change Their Role
Artificial Intelligence is becoming part of the modern development toolkit.
AI can generate code, assist with troubleshooting, and speed up development workflows.
However, businesses still need developers who can:
- Understand requirements
- Solve complex problems
- Design scalable systems
- Validate data accuracy
- Communicate with stakeholders
The ability to think critically and understand business needs will continue to be just as important as technical expertise.
As AI handles more routine tasks, human judgment becomes even more valuable.
Why Communication Matters More Than Ever
The stereotype of developers working in isolation is becoming increasingly outdated.
Today’s Full Stack Developers regularly collaborate with:
- Business stakeholders
- Project managers
- Designers
- Operations teams
- End users
Technical skills may get a developer hired, but communication skills often determine their long-term success.
The best developers don’t just understand technology.
They understand people, processes, and business goals.
What This Means for Future Developers
As businesses become more data-driven, the most successful developers will likely be those who combine technical expertise with a deeper understanding of data and business operations.
This means continuing to build skills in:
- SQL and database development
- Reporting and analytics
- Data integration
- Cloud technologies
- Automation
- Communication and collaboration
Developers who can connect technology with business outcomes will remain highly valuable regardless of how tools and technologies evolve.
Final Thoughts
The future of Full Stack Development is about more than building software.
Organizations increasingly need developers who can understand data, automate processes, integrate systems, and help people make better decisions.
The developers who stand out won’t necessarily be the ones who know the most programming languages. They’ll be the ones who can use technology to solve real business problems.
For professionals looking to grow their careers, developing strong SQL, data, and problem-solving skills isn’t just a technical advantage—it’s an investment in a future where data drives nearly every business decision.

Interested in a role where you can apply these skills?
We’re currently hiring a Full Stack Developer (SQL-Focused) to help build data-driven solutions, reporting systems, integrations, and business applications that support not-for-profits and small-to-medium businesses. If you enjoy solving problems with technology and turning data into meaningful insights, we’d love to hear from you.
